NEW QUESTION # 47
You schedule a Maintenance Service Plan. Which call object is generated?

  • A. Maintenance Order which is linked to a Service Order Item
  • B. Customer Service Order with assigned DIP profile
  • C. Customer Service Order with an external order operation
  • D. Maintenance Order which is linked to a Service Order Header

Answer: A

Explanation:
Explanation
A Maintenance Service Plan is a type of Maintenance Plan that is used to schedule periodic services for external customers. When a Maintenance Service Plan is scheduled, a Maintenance Service Call is generated, which contains a Customer Service Order Header and a Maintenance Order. The Maintenance Order is linked to a Service Order Item, which represents the serviceable material or asset. The Maintenance Order contains the technical details of the service, such as operations, components, and confirmations. The Service Order Item contains the commercial details of the service, such as pricing, billing, and credit check. The Maintenance Order and the Service Order Item are integrated through the Dynamic Item Processor (DIP), which transfers the costs and revenues between them. References: Maintenance Service Plan and Maintenance Service Order in SAP Help Portal.

NEW QUESTION # 51
How does a maintenance request within the phase-based process differ from a maintenance notification in the standard process?

  • A. It is a new business object with no connection to a maintenance notification.
  • B. It contains an additional screening phase where requests can be accepted or rejected.
  • C. It is mandatory to assign a task list to the maintenance request.
  • D. It always uses the risk-based assessment for prioritization.

Answer: B

Explanation:
Explanation
A maintenance request within the phase-based process differs from a maintenance notification in the standard process in that it contains an additional screening phase where requests can be acceptedor rejected. In the standard process, a maintenance notification is created and processed without any screening. In the phase-based process, a maintenance request is created and submitted for screening. The screening phase allows the supervisor to review the request and decide whether to accept it or reject it. If the request is accepted, it becomes a maintenance notification and moves to the planning phase. If the request is rejected, it is closed and no further action is taken1.
The other options are incorrect because:
A maintenance request does not always use the risk-based assessment for prioritization. It can also use a predefined priority list2.
A maintenance request is not a new business object with no connection to a maintenance notification. It is a maintenance notification that is in the initiation or screening phase3.
It is not mandatory to assign a task list to the maintenance request. A task list can be assigned to the maintenance order in the planning phase4.
References: Explaining the Phase-based Process, New Phase Model for the Maintenance Processes in S/4HANA Cloud, SAP S/4HANA Cloud release of 2011 - Asset Management (Maintenance Management), Introducing Reactive Maintenance (4HH)

NEW QUESTION # 54
What do you have to consider when setting up phase-based maintenance?

  • A. It is not possible to configure the nine delivered phases.
  • B. It can be used with any existing order type.
  • C. It is mandatory for breakdown and preventive maintenance.
  • D. It comes preconfigured when using the relevant Best Practices scope items.

Answer: A,D

Explanation:
Explanation
Phase-based maintenance is a new concept introduced in SAP S/4HANA Cloud that allows you to track the life cycle of the maintenance processes using nine predefined phases and sub-phases. These phases are set up by SAP and you cannot change them. However, you can control the transition of phases using phase control codes. Phase-based maintenance is only applicable to the new order types Reactive Maintenance and Proactive Maintenance, which are delivered with the relevant Best Practices scope items. It is not mandatory for breakdown and preventive maintenance, nor can it be used with any existing order type. References: New Phase Model for the Maintenance Processes in S/4HANA Cloud, Phase Model for the Maintenance Process, Maintenance Process Phases, Explaining the Phase-based Process

NEW QUESTION # 63
The maintenance engineer creates a strategy plan with the call object maintenance order. Shift factors are set to 100% which date is relevant for the calculation of future planned dates if the maintenance work is delayed?

  • A. Actual finish date of the maintenance order
  • B. Planned date of the next call, independent of maintenance order dates
  • C. Technical completion date of the maintenance order
  • D. The date of the final confirmation

Answer: A

Explanation:
Explanation
A strategy plan is a type of maintenance plan that defines different maintenance packages with different intervals for the same technical object. The system calculates the due dates for the maintenance packages based on the maintenance strategy assigned to the plan. The maintenance strategy contains the cycles and the shift factors for each package. The shift factors determine how the system shifts the planned dates of the next maintenance call when the maintenance work is delayed or performed earlier than planned. If the shift factor is
100%, the system shifts the planned date by the same number of days as the delay or the advance. If the shift factor is 0%, the system does not shift the planned date at all. The call object of a maintenance plan is the object that the system generates when a maintenance call is due. The call object can be a maintenance order, a maintenance notification, a service entry sheet, or a purchase requisition. If the call object is a maintenance order, the system uses the actual finish date of the maintenance order to calculate the future planned dates for the maintenance packages. The actual finish date is the date when the maintenance work is completed and confirmed. The planned date of the next call, the date of the final confirmation, and the technical completion date of the maintenance orderare not relevant for the calculation of future planned dates if the maintenance work is delayed. References:
Explaining Maintenance Plans, section "Strategy Maintenance Plan"
Maintenance Plan Category, section "Service order"
Maintenance Plan, section "Maintenance Plan with Strategy"
